If you see the donkey of someone who hates you fallen under its load, you must not ignore him, but be sure to help him with it.
“You must not turn away justice for your poor people in their lawsuits.
Keep your distance from a false charge– do not kill the innocent and the righteous, for I will not justify the wicked.
“You must not accept a bribe, for a bribe blinds those who see and subverts the words of the righteous.
“You must not oppress a resident foreigner, since you know the life of a foreigner, for you were foreigners in the land of Egypt.
Sabbaths and Feasts“For six years you are to sow your land and gather in its produce.
But in the seventh year you must let it lie fallow and leave it alone so that the poor of your people may eat, and what they leave any animal in the field may eat; you must do likewise with your vineyard and your olive grove.
